City of Report Number 13-244 <br /> g)NFIW Agenda Section VI-7 <br /> BRIGI-ITON Council Meeting Date October 22, 2013 <br /> the city that works for you <br /> REQUEST FOR COUNCIL CONSIDERATION <br /> ITEM DESCRIPTION: Approval of Joint Powers Agreement with Ramsey County for New Voting <br /> System Acquisition and Operation <br /> DEPARTMENT HEAD'S APPROVAL: <br /> CITY MANAGER'S APPROVAL: <br /> No comments to supplement this report Comments attached <br /> Recommendation: Approve the Joint Powers Agreement with Ramsey County for New Voting System <br /> Acquisition and Operation. <br /> Legislative History: Ramsey County cities entered into a joint powers agreement(JPA)with Ramsey <br /> County in 2001 to purchase and operate the voting system. The current draft JPA has been updated to <br /> reflect current practices, Congress mandated use of assistive ballot marking devices for use by voters with <br /> disabilities or Help America Vote Act(HAVA),the Minnesota Legislature mandated central counting of <br /> all absentee ballots, and the acquisition of a new voting system and equipment. <br /> Staff became aware of the need to update the existing JPA while attending an elections meeting at the <br /> County last July. An article was included in the City Manager's weekly memo to the City Council at that <br /> time. Since then the JPA has been reviewed by the City Attorney as well as a LMC attorney. The <br /> updated JPA includes changes as a result of those recommendations. <br /> Financial Impact: Our current system is 14 years old. The new system is expected to last 14 years also. <br /> Ramsey County will bear the initial purchase cost of the new system and the cities will be invoiced for <br /> their respective portions. Ramsey County anticipates the total cost to be about$2,276,600. New <br /> Brighton's share of the capital costs is estimated to be about$44,875. The replacement of our voting <br /> equipment is included in the City Manager's Recommended 2014 Non-Fleet Budget. We have <br /> accumulated sufficient monies for the replacement in 2014. The estimated share of the operating costs <br /> will increase. The City Manager's Recommended 2014 Elections Budget reflects that increase. <br /> Explanation: The efficient ballot preparation and the timely compilation of elections results depend <br /> upon the use of a uniform voting system throughout Ramsey County. The use of a uniform voting system <br /> for all elections enhances voter and election judge understanding and helps to provide equitable treatment <br /> for all voters, regardless of the type of election. The Minnesota Legislature mandated the central counting <br /> of all absentee ballots under uniform state laws and procedures effective in 2010. <br /> The Ramsey County facilitates the entire election process within the county. The updated JPA reflects <br /> roles and responsibilities for the County and each municipality within the County. The previous <br /> agreement worked very well for the City in the past but needed to be updated as stated earlier. <br /> Dan Maiers <br /> Finance Director <br />
